    You should be ok for the most part. I've never seen damage caused by it, just major inconvenience. Might need new pads in the spring if it happens a lot. Maybe carry a deadblow/or heavy rubber hammer to whack the backing plate if it's real stubborn

    You might try a liberal application of WD-40 on the e-cable sheath and all the moving parts, except inside the drums of course. That should help repel the water/ice and prevent rust at the same time. Not sure about the 2nd gens, I think your cable runs different than the 1st, but I can crawl underneath mine and yank the cable to release it if needed.
